Pennsylvania State Police, Pennsylvania
End of Watch Sunday, August 22, 1909
Add to My HeroesJohn L. Williams
Private John Williams and Private Jack Smith were shot and killed by a mob while responding to a riotous strike at the Pressed Steel Car Company plant in McKees Rocks. After killing the officers the mob robbed them of cash and other possessions.
Deputy Harry Exley, of the Allegheny County Sheriff's Department, was also shot and killed during the riots.
Private Williams was a United States Army veteran and served with the Pennsylvania State Police for two years. He was assigned to Troop A, Greensburg. He was survived by his mother.
